The Kitty Clean-up Crew

New business in town: the kitty clean-up crew;
twenty-four/seven, we’re here for you.

On-the-job training if you’d like to help,
but, really, we’d rather just do it ourselves.

We’ll consider each and every call,
but spilled milk is our favorite job of all.

This little toddler is cute as can be,
and she’s what we call job security.

No payment is due when we finish the task:
tummy rubs and ear scritches are all that we ask.
